Vertical Integration
A strategy where a company expands its operations into different stages of production within the same industry, controlling multiple aspects of its supply chain.
Value Creation
The process by which companies or individuals generate increased worth for a product, service, or brand, often leading to competitive advantage and higher profitability.
Strategy Formulation
The process of developing plans and actions to achieve organizational goals and objectives, taking into account internal strengths and weaknesses and external opportunities and threats.
Strategic Management Process
A methodical approach involving the formulation and implementation of major initiatives and goals taken by a company's top management on behalf of owners, based on the assessment of internal and external environments.
